Part of his vision is seen in the beautiful bulkheads found throughout the interiors. As a specialist in this field, these were designed by the owner and his home became the ultimate blank canvas for him to explore his creativity.
Light fittings have been innovatively incorporated to not only illuminate the spaces but to create attention-grabbing focal points. The light fixtures such as the chandeliers, are modern but with a classical theme.
For the interior, the owners opted for an earthy feel which was achieved with a muted palette of neutral hues. An interior designer was not used but ideas and inspiration were taken from magazines. The colour scheme for the furniture and soft furnishings consists mostly of oranges and browns.
The kitchen and the dining area form the heart of the home. The culinary space is fully equipped with all the mod-cons with a contemporary yet classic look that uses clean straight lines, designer countertops and wood cabinetry.
Stepping outside, its hard not to have your breath taken away by the stunning architecture while the use of white evokes visions of the White House to further accentuate the glamour of the home. The grand entrance has been marvelously framed by bold pillars and sets the stage for what is yet to come – a grand home that is a vision turned reality.
